Compass And Mini-Trip Computer Module - Operation






OPERATION

The Compass Temperature Display system uses both non-switched and ignition switched sources of battery current so that some of its features remain operational at any time, while others may only operate with the ignition switch in the ON position. When the ignition switch is turned to the ON position, the display will return to the last function being displayed before the ignition was turned to the OFF position. Pressing and holding the instrument cluster pushbutton allows setting variance zones and manual calibration of the compass.

The Compass Temperature Display system is comprised of several different components that communicate over the Controller Area Network (CAN) and Local Interface Network (LIN) Data Bus circuits. If the system is inoperative a scan tool and the appropriate diagnostic information must be used to diagnose the system and related data buses.
